QQQM vs EQWL
Invesco NASDAQ 100 ETF vs Invesco S&P 100 Equal Weight ETF
Key differences
- QQQM costs 0.10% less per year.
- QQQM is significantly larger than EQWL — larger funds tend to be more liquid and less likely to close.
- Over the last 3 years, QQQM has delivered higher annualized returns.
- EQWL has a longer track record, which may reduce uncertainty around long-term behavior.
